What's the best way to check your understanding of the material you took notes on? A. Quizzing yourself using the questions you

wrote while covering up your notes B. Using flash cards C. Drawing pictures that represent your notes D. Highlighting the material you don't know
English
2 answers:
Lady_Fox [76]3 years ago
5 0
It depends on your learning type (kinetic, visual, auditory, etc.) however most evidence proves that                     A.) quizzing yourself                     would be the best answer
